Flux 2 Klein is Black Forest Labs' compact 4-billion parameter model, designed for speed and cost efficiency. It generates 1-megapixel images in about a second at budget pricing, making it one of the cheapest options available. Juggernaut Flux Pro is RunDiffusion's fine-tuned version of the Flux architecture, specifically optimized for photorealistic human subjects—it's widely regarded as having the best skin texture rendering of any available model.
These models serve fundamentally different purposes. Klein excels at rapid iteration and high-volume workflows where cost matters more than perfection. Juggernaut Flux Pro targets professional photography use cases—portraits, fashion, lifestyle—where human subjects need to look genuinely photographic rather than AI-generated. The 27× price difference reflects this specialization gap.
Both models support image-to-image generation, but their strengths differ dramatically. Klein handles diverse subjects adequately across all categories. Juggernaut is specifically tuned for human photorealism—skin pores, hair strands, the subtle imperfections that make a face look real. For non-human subjects, Juggernaut still performs well but its unique advantages are less pronounced.
Generation speed also differs significantly: Klein completes in roughly 1 second while Juggernaut takes approximately 4 seconds. For interactive applications or bulk processing, this 4x speed difference compounds with the cost difference to make Klein vastly more economical for appropriate use cases.
Note: Juggernaut Flux Pro's photorealism advantage is most visible in close-up portraits and any image where skin quality is scrutinized. For landscapes, products, or stylized content, the premium may not be justified.
